Sånta Rita-Sumai, Guam
Village in Guam, United States / From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Sånta Rita-Sumai, formerly Santa Rita and encompassing the former municipality of Sumay, is a village located on the southwest coast of the United States territory of Guam with hills overlooking Apra Harbor. According to the 2020 census it has a population of 6,470, which is up slightly from 6,084 in 2010 but down from 11,857 in 1990.[1] Santa Rita is the newest village in Guam, having been established after the Second World War.
